Píritu, located in the Anzoátegui state of Venezuela, is a coastal town that offers a variety of attractions and benefits for travelers. Here are some potential pros of visiting Píritu:
Beautiful Beaches: Píritu is known for its scenic beaches along the Caribbean Sea. These beaches are less crowded compared to other tourist destinations, offering a more tranquil and relaxing experience.
Local Culture and History: The town has a rich history, with colonial architecture and cultural heritage sites. Visitors can explore local traditions and enjoy the charm of a small Venezuelan coastal town.
Seafood Cuisine: Being a coastal town, Píritu offers fresh seafood. Travelers can enjoy local dishes prepared with freshly caught fish and other seafood, providing an authentic taste of Venezuelan coastal cuisine.
Outdoor Activities: The natural environment around Píritu allows for various outdoor activities such as swimming, fishing, and beach sports. The surrounding areas also offer opportunities for exploring and enjoying nature.
Warm Climate: Píritu has a tropical climate, making it a great destination for those who enjoy warm weather. The climate is typically warm and humid, perfect for beachgoers.
Friendly Locals: Visitors often find the local residents to be welcoming and hospitable, which can enhance the travel experience.
Proximity to Other Attractions: Píritu is located relatively close to other attractions in the Anzoátegui state, allowing for day trips to explore more of the region. This includes visits to other coastal towns, natural parks, and cultural sites.
Affordable Travel Destination: Compared to more popular tourist locations, Píritu can be a more budget-friendly destination, offering affordable accommodations and dining options.
While these are some of the potential benefits of visiting Píritu, it's important for travelers to research current conditions, safety, and travel advisories, as these can impact the travel experience.
